Choosing the Right Epoxy Resin
Selecting the appropriate epoxy resin is paramount for a successful project. Consider the intended application; for instance, “Ultra Clear Bar and Table Top Epoxy” is ideal for furniture, while “Ultra Clear Deep Pour Epoxy” suits thicker applications. Reputable brands ensure high-quality results. Check for specific properties like UV resistance to prevent yellowing over time and scratch resistance for durability. The resin’s viscosity also matters; lower viscosity resins are easier to pour and self-level, while higher viscosity resins might be better suited for thicker projects or vertical surfaces. Always carefully review the manufacturer’s instructions, paying close attention to mixing ratios and curing times, which may vary depending on the brand and specific product. Don’t forget to calculate the necessary quantity to avoid running short during your project. Choosing the right resin forms the foundation of a successful outcome.
Measuring and Mixing for Optimal Results
Precise measurement is critical when working with epoxy resin. Use containers with clear measurement markings to ensure accuracy, especially for larger batches. Many manufacturers recommend using a ratio of 2⁚1 or 1⁚1 resin to hardener; however, always refer to your specific product’s instructions. Inaccurate ratios can lead to incomplete curing, a sticky finish, or even a complete failure of the epoxy to set. Thoroughly mix the resin and hardener using a low-speed mixer or a sturdy stir stick for a minimum of 1-2 minutes to ensure a homogenous blend. Avoid introducing air bubbles by stirring gently but thoroughly, scraping the sides and bottom of the container. For larger volumes, consider using a vacuum chamber to remove air bubbles before application. Remember, meticulous measuring and mixing are essential for achieving a flawless, professional-looking finish.
Surface Preparation⁚ Key to a Successful Project
Proper surface preparation is paramount for achieving a strong, durable, and visually appealing epoxy finish. Begin by thoroughly cleaning the surface to remove any dust, dirt, grease, wax, or oil. Use a suitable cleaner appropriate for the material; denatured alcohol or a mild detergent solution often work well. Allow the surface to dry completely before proceeding. For porous materials like wood, consider applying a sealant to prevent the epoxy from absorbing into the surface and weakening the bond. Sanding the surface to create a smooth, even texture is usually beneficial, particularly for applications like tabletops or countertops. This step helps ensure optimal adhesion and prevents imperfections from showing through the clear epoxy layer. Remember to remove any sanding dust before applying the epoxy to avoid compromising the final finish. Careful surface preparation significantly impacts the overall success and longevity of your project.
Application Techniques⁚ Brushing, Rolling, and Pouring
The application method for ultra-clear epoxy depends on the project’s scale and desired finish. For small projects or intricate details, a fine-bristled brush allows for precise control and even coverage. Apply thin, even coats to avoid runs and drips. For larger, flat surfaces like tabletops, a roller provides efficient coverage, ensuring a smooth, uniform finish. Use a low-nap roller to minimize air bubbles. For deep pours or creating thicker epoxy layers, the pouring method is preferred. Pour the mixed epoxy slowly and steadily to avoid creating air bubbles. A slow, controlled pour minimizes the formation of bubbles. Consider using a heat gun or torch to carefully pop any surface bubbles after pouring. Regardless of the chosen method, work in a well-ventilated area and avoid dust or debris during application. Following the manufacturer’s instructions regarding application techniques is crucial for achieving the best possible results and a flawless, professional finish.
Curing Time and Environmental Factors
The curing time for ultra-clear epoxy resin is significantly influenced by environmental conditions and the thickness of the applied layer. Higher temperatures generally accelerate the curing process, while lower temperatures slow it down. Humidity also plays a role; high humidity can extend curing time and potentially affect the final clarity. Thicker pours require longer curing times compared to thinner coats. Manufacturers typically provide estimated curing times, but these should be considered guidelines. For instance, a thin coat might cure within 12-24 hours under ideal conditions (room temperature, low humidity), whereas a thicker pour could take significantly longer, potentially up to several days. Always allow for complete curing before handling or using the finished project. Improper curing can lead to a sticky or incompletely hardened surface. Monitoring temperature and humidity during the curing process can help ensure optimal results and prevent potential problems.

UV Resistance and Yellowing Prevention
Ultra-clear epoxy’s resistance to ultraviolet (UV) light is a critical factor determining its long-term aesthetic appeal. Prolonged exposure to sunlight and other UV sources can cause many clear resins to yellow over time, diminishing their clarity and overall visual impact. High-quality ultra-clear epoxies are formulated with specialized UV stabilizers and inhibitors to mitigate this yellowing effect. These additives act as a protective barrier, absorbing or deflecting harmful UV rays before they can damage the resin’s molecular structure and cause discoloration. The effectiveness of these UV protectors varies depending on the resin’s formulation and the intensity of UV exposure. Therefore, choosing a resin with a proven track record of UV resistance is essential for projects that will be displayed in areas with significant sunlight or other UV sources. By selecting a reputable brand and following the manufacturer’s instructions, you can significantly extend the life of your project and maintain its pristine, crystal-clear appearance for years.
Scratch and Fade Resistance
The scratch and fade resistance of ultra-clear epoxy is paramount for ensuring the longevity and aesthetic appeal of your finished project. High-quality epoxy resins are formulated with durable polymers that provide excellent resistance to scratches and abrasions. This characteristic is crucial for applications like tabletops, countertops, and art pieces, which may experience regular wear and tear. The degree of scratch resistance can vary depending on the specific epoxy formulation and the thickness of the applied coating. Thicker coats generally offer superior scratch protection. Furthermore, the fade resistance of the epoxy is equally important. Exposure to sunlight and other environmental factors can cause some materials to lose their vibrancy over time. A high-quality ultra-clear epoxy should exhibit minimal fading, maintaining its clarity and original appearance for years to come. To maximize scratch and fade resistance, it’s essential to properly prepare the surface before application and follow the manufacturer’s instructions for mixing and curing.
Adhesion and Bonding Capabilities
Ultra-clear epoxy’s exceptional adhesion and bonding capabilities are key to its versatility. The strong chemical bonds formed by the epoxy resin ensure a robust and lasting connection between different materials. This makes it ideal for a wide range of applications, from bonding wood and metal to creating durable seals and encapsulating delicate items. Proper surface preparation is essential to achieve optimal adhesion. Clean, dry surfaces free of dust, grease, and other contaminants will maximize the bond strength. The specific adhesion properties of an epoxy resin can vary depending on the type of materials being bonded. Some formulations are specifically designed for particular substrates, offering superior bonding strength in those applications. Always consult the manufacturer’s instructions for recommendations on surface preparation and specific applications. Furthermore, the curing time and environmental conditions can also influence the final bond strength. Allowing sufficient time for the epoxy to cure completely will ensure the strongest possible bond, resistant to stress and environmental factors.

Tabletops and Countertops
Creating stunning, durable tabletops and countertops with ultra-clear epoxy requires careful preparation and precise execution. Begin by ensuring the surface is meticulously clean, dry, and free from dust, grease, or wax. For optimal adhesion, consider using a suitable primer, especially on porous materials like wood. Select a high-quality epoxy resin designed for bar tops and table applications; many brands offer specific formulations for this purpose. Measure and mix the resin and hardener according to the manufacturer’s instructions, typically using a precise ratio. Thorough mixing is crucial to prevent uneven curing and potential imperfections. Pour the epoxy onto the prepared surface, spreading it evenly to achieve a consistent thickness. To minimize air bubbles, gently agitate the surface using a low-speed mixer or a heat gun, taking care to avoid creating ripples. Allow ample curing time, ensuring the environment is suitable for proper hardening as per the manufacturer’s recommendations. A final polishing may enhance the shine and reveal the stunning clarity of the finished tabletop or countertop.
Art and Craft Projects
Ultra-clear epoxy resin opens a world of creative possibilities for artists and crafters. Its exceptional clarity allows for the creation of stunning, three-dimensional artwork, preserving the vibrancy of embedded materials. Before starting, prepare your workspace meticulously, ensuring a clean and dust-free environment. Choose a suitable mold or form for your project; silicone molds are popular choices due to their flexibility and ease of use. Carefully mix the resin and hardener according to the manufacturer’s instructions, using a low-speed mixer to minimize air bubbles. Gently pour the mixture into the mold, taking care to avoid trapping air bubbles. For larger projects or deeper pours, consider using a pressure pot to eliminate bubbles effectively. Once poured, allow the epoxy to cure undisturbed, following the manufacturer’s recommended curing time and temperature guidelines. After curing, carefully remove the finished piece from the mold. Depending on the project, a final sanding and polishing may enhance the piece’s aesthetic appeal.
